计算机专业是一个包含多个领域的学科,由于其广泛性和复杂性,人们通常会将计算机专业按照不同的分类方法进行划分。以下是几种常见的计算机专业分类方法和相关技能:
1.按照应用领域分类
计算机专业可以根据应用领域进行分类,例如:
- 计算机科学:包括算法、数据结构、计算机架构等基础理论和编程技能,主要用于开发计算机软件和硬件。
- 计算机工程:主要关注计算机系统的设计、开发和维护,包括硬件设计、嵌入式系统、网络工程等方向。
- 人工智能:涉及机器学习、深度学习、自然语言处理等技术,主要应用于智能化系统的开发。
- 数据科学:主要关注数据分析、统计学和机器学习等技术,以及相关的编程语言和工具。
- 游戏开发:包括游戏设计、图形学、物理引擎等技术,主要用于开发游戏软件和游戏引擎。
2.按照编程语言分类
计算机专业可以根据编程语言进行分类,例如:
- Java开发:Java是一种面向对象的编程语言,广泛用于企业级应用、Web应用和移动应用等方面。
- Python开发:Python是一种高级编程语言,主要用于数据科学、机器学习和Web开发等领域。
- C++开发:C++是一种高级编程语言,主要用于系统编程、嵌入式系统和图形学等领域。
- JavaScript开发:JavaScript是一种脚本语言,主要用于Web开发、前端开发和游戏开发等领域。
- PHP开发:PHP是一种服务器端脚本语言,主要用于Web开发、动态网页和电子商务等领域。
3.按照技术方向分类
计算机专业可以根据技术方向进行分类,例如:
- 数据库管理:涉及数据库设计、管理和维护等方面的技术。
- 网络安全:涉及计算机网络的安全和保护技术,包括防火墙、加密、认证等方面。
- 人机交互:主要关注人类与计算机交互的技术,包括界面设计、用户体验和人机交互设计等方面。
- 云计算:主要关注云计算技术的开发、部署和维护,包括云计算基础设施、云计算平台和云计算应用等方面。
以上是计算机专业的几种常见分类方法和相关技能,每一种分类方法都有其独特的特点和技术要求,学生可以根据自己的兴趣和天赋选择适合自己的方向进行学习和研究。
上一篇:读研影响找对象吗男生
下一篇:梦见头发掉了很多什么意思